User:alexiapeke478685

From myWiki
Jump to navigation Jump to search

Spain has established a name for its high-quality business education. Many schools offer comprehensive programs that attract students from internationally. If you're considering an international

https://links2directory.com/listings13052752/leading-international-business-universities-in-spain

Retrieved from ‘https://wikibriefing.com